What is recorded here

In pasture, on NW-facing slope just below top of hill. Circular area (diam. 46m) enclosed by earthen bank (max. int. H 1.7m) E->SSW; scarp (H 1.6m) NW->NNE; external fosse (D 1.35m) SE->SSW with counterscarp bank (H 0.25m). Bank stone-faced internally to height of 1.4m. Scarp topped by stone field boundary. Interior level for c. 7m inside S bank; remainder slopes gently down to NW. Visible as circular enclosure in aerial photograph (GSIAP; W 21). The above description is derived from the published 'Archaeological Inventory of County Cork. Volume 3: Mid Cork' (Dublin: Stationery Office, 1997). In certain instances the entries have been revised and updated in the light of recent research. Date of upload/revision: 14 January 2009
